According to Daily Express, Chelsea are on the verge of losing Olivier Giroud to Inter Milan this summer.

However, The World cup winner has become an important player in Frank Lampard’s starting XI in recent weeks but with his contract expiring at the end of the season, Giroud’s future at Chelsea is uncertain.

Conte tried to sign the French international during the January transfer window and even agreed personal terms but Chelsea pulled the plug on the move after failing to line up a replacement. The Serie A club are still interested in the 33 year old striker and have told his representatives that they still want a deal.

While Chelsea are offering Giroud a one year deal, Inter Milan are happy to offer the Frenchman a two year deal to swap Stamford Bridge for the San Siro this summer.

Giroud has managed 2 goals in 5 Premier League starts for Chelsea this season and recently reaffirmed his desire to renew his contract in west London.

When asked if he would like to stay at Chelsea, Giroud said: “Yes. Yes. Yeah, yeah, yeah. Of course.

“There are a few months to go, games to win and maybe another trophy, and after, you know, I think I have two (or) three nice seasons in front of me.

“It’s not the time to talk about contracts and everything but I will take a decision when it comes.”
